Thank you so much for the information. When I want to store my violin for few months inside my closet should I loosen the strings a little to avoid breaking in case the changes in temperature ?
@KennedyViolins
4 жыл бұрын
You should definitely NOT loosen the strings. The more the violin resembles how it would exist while being played the better. You do not want the violin to sit for a long time in a state that is completely the opposite of what you want it to be when you play it because when the violin is eventually played, it'll be a bigger shock to the instrument, which could cause damage and other issues.
